  1. Angela Margaret Scoular (born 8th November 1945 in Chelsea, London; died 11th April 2011 in Maida Vale, London) appeared on Coronation Street in June 1972 as Sue Silcock. She was educated at Queen's College, London and graduated from RADA in 1966.

  2. Her television credits included playing Cathy in a 1967 BBC production of Wuthering Heights, Doctor in the House, The Avengers, Coronation Street, Penmarric, As Time Goes By and You Rang, M'Lord? (in the recurring role of Lady Agatha Shawcross).

  6. Angela Scoular was born on 8 November 1945 in London, England, UK. She was an actress, known for On Her Majesty's Secret Service (1969), Casino Royale (1967) and You Rang, M'Lord? (1988). She was married to Leslie Phillips. She died on 11 April 2011 in Maida Vale, London, England, UK.
